THE GRUESOME Pendle Witch trials are brought almost to life this week as Tussaud's Waxworks gets into the Halloween vibe.
But watch out -- there might just be a live witch or two among the exhibits, as Citizen photographer Glen Gater found!
Tussaud's, on Central Promenade, Blackpool, is also hosting a children's party tomorrow (Friday, October 31) 5pm-8pm, promising lots of ghoulish fun such as 'pin the wart on the witch'.
Admission into the children's party is £6 per child or adult (children's tickets include a finger buffet). All children must be accompanied by a full paying adult.
Guests can also explore all five floors of the attraction, which is home to over 150 eerily lifelike waxwork figures, including those in the Chamber of Horrors...
